Written by Gertjan on May 12th, 2009For most dynamic websites you will want to create “Search Engine Friendly” or “User Friendly” URLs, rather than using ugly and meaningless strings or IDs to reference your content. The way you interpret the URLs and use them to get your content is for another article and I won’t go into that right now, what I want to talk about is how to turn your page titles into versions that can be used in your URL.
For example you have a page called “Search Engine Friendly URLs”. In the URL you will ideally want to have this string, only lowercase and with dashes in place of the spaces: “search-engine-friendly-urls”. Therefore the URL to the page becomes “http://www.yourdomain.com/search-engine-friendly-urls/” or similar.
